As my final year individual university project, I led the design and development of a small fixed-wing VTOL UAV with tilt rotors, integrating multiple disciplines including electronics, control systems, aerodynamics, fluid mechanics, and structural analysis. This involved developing servo-actuated transition control, conducting CFD studies to evaluate aerodynamic performance, testing structural components (with a focus on wing resonance and deflection), and managing the project to deliver a working concept within strict deadlines.
